Wout Weghorst, well-known for his time at Burnley and Manchester United, begins a new chapter by signing a season-long loan with the Bundesliga team, Hoffenheim.

The 31-year-old Dutch striker made his impact at several clubs throughout a journey that included transfers and loans.

Burnley acquired Weghorst for £12 million in 2022 from the Bundesliga club Wolfsburg, He scored two goals and provided three assists in 20 appearances for Burnley.

Weghorst started last season at the Turkish club Besiktas on loan from Burnley but spent the later part of the season at Manchester United, also on loan. He scored twice in 31 games for the Red Devils.

He had a bigger tally in Germany.

The Dutch striker scored 70 goals and provided 22 assists for Wolfsburg, playing for the German club from 2018 till his transfer to Burnley.

He is expected to do better again in the Bundesliga.

Weghorst is the new hope for Hoffenheim under manager Pellegrino Matarazzo’s guidance.

Hoffenheim, a team with high expectations after finishing in 12th place, are looking forward to utilising his knowledge and work ethic to strengthen their attacking squad.

This transfer, hailed by Hoffenheim’s managing director, Alexander Rosen, as “remarkable and unparalleled”, reflects the team’s faith in Weghorst. 

Rosen said, ”I don’t think I’m exaggerating when I describe this transfer as significant and extraordinary. It certainly is for us. The fact that a striker with his track record and all the options available to him has chosen Hoffenheim shows that the club are attractive even to big-named players.” an article from sportskeeda.com shared.

Hannibal Mejbri: Man U to extend contract?

Meanwhile, Manchester United are negotiating a contract extension with talented midfielder Hannibal Mejbri. His existing contract is set to conclude in 2024, with an additional one-year option, reports sportskeeda.com.

The 20-year-old Tunisian international born in France joined the Manchester United youth system in 2019 from the French club Monaco. He was loaned to the Championship club Birmingham City in the 2022-23 season.

Mejbri impressed Manchester United manager Erik ten Hag, who doesn’t want to sell him.

The Red Devils have a big pool of midfielders, though, and are looking to offload some.

Mejbri is not short of takers.

Luton Town, the French club Stade Rennais, and another English team are interested in loaning Mejbri. With 40 games, six goals, and an astounding 17 assists during his time with United U21, he stands out as a rising star.
